Pedestrian Killed in Early Morning Crash in East Baton Rouge Parish
Baton Rouge – Shortly after 5:00 a.m. on Tuesday, July 29, 2025, Troopers from Louisiana State Police Troop A began investigating a fatal crash involving a pedestrian on US 61, just south of LA 42 in East Baton Rouge Parish. The crash claimed the life of 48-year-old Travis Weams of Prairieville.
The initial investigation revealed that a 2012 Toyota Camry, driven by Weams, had previously crashed on US 61 northbound near Manchac Park Road. After the initial crash, Weams exited his vehicle, crossed the median, and walked into the northbound lane of US 61. At that time, a 2019 Mack garbage truck struck Weams. After initial impact, he was struck again by a 2016 Ford Mustang.
Weams sustained fatal injuries and was pronounced deceased on the scene. Both drivers of the Mack truck and the Mustang were properly restrained and reported no injuries. Impairment is not suspected for either driver; however, standard toxicology samples were collected from both drivers and Weams for analysis. This crash remains under investigation.
